This is, by far, the worst theater I have ever been to. I had boycotted this place many years ago due to their pitifully low standards, and after being convinced by a friend, I decided to give it one last shot. Unsurprisingly, nothing has changed. To be fair, the prices here are reasonable, although that seems to be the only compliment I can think of. The theater is filled with the lovely aroma of wet dog or something equally as foul and as for the the«quality» of the show, I would not be surprised if they were still using the same equipment that was installed when they built the place in the 90’s. The picture was extremely muddy and dark, the slightly concave screen caused image warping, and the overall image was soft and defocused. Sound quality was mediocre and any hint that surround sound was present was nonexistent. I have given this theater 3 chances over the past 12 years and I have had this same awful experience each time. For me, this was their last chance to receive my patronage as I will not be returning again.
